Symptom
A self-assigned course is showing "Buy Course" button on Learning Plan instead of "Start Course" button even though the price is set to 0.
Environment
SAP SuccessFactors Learning
Reproducing the Issue
- Create an item with price is 0 and set the purchasing option other than 'No Charge'
- Associate a Library to the item.
- User self-assign the item > It shows 'Start Course' button on Learning Plan
- Admin removes the associated Library from the item
- Now it shows 'Buy Course' button on user's Learning Plan
Cause
The system cannot find the exact price if the associated libraries were removed from the item after user did self-assignment.
This leads to the system needing to complete the charging process, resulting in the display of "Buy Course" button instead of "Start Course".
Resolution
There are 2 solutions:
- Set the Purchasing Option in Item > Purchasing tab to 'No Charge'.
Or
- Add back the libraries to the item which the affected users can access.
See Also
Keywords
Buy Course, Start Course, Self-Assignment, Course Price, No Charge, Learning Plan , KBA , LOD-SF-LMS-ITE , Items , Problem
Product
SAP SuccessFactors Learning all versions